Pork and Vegetable Glass Noodles — Pork Japchae

Korean glass noodle stir-fry with sliced pork shoulder, spinach, carrot, shiitake, and onion in a soy-sesame glaze, finished with toasted sesame seeds and sliced scallion.

Instructions

1

Prep

Thinly slice 400g pork shoulder against the grain. Soak 120g glass noodles in warm water 10 minutes, drain. Julienne 120g carrot, thinly slice 100g shiitake caps and 160g onion. Finely grate 6 garlic cloves, slice 2 scallions. Toss pork with 2 tbsp soy, 2 tsp sugar, 2 tsp sesame oil, 2 garlic cloves, and black pepper; rest 8 minutes.

2

Boil

Cook drained noodles in salted water over high heat 5 minutes until just tender. Drain, rinse under cold water, toss with 2 tsp sesame oil. Blanch 140g spinach in salted boiling water 30 seconds, drain, squeeze dry, toss with 2 tsp sesame oil and salt to taste.

3

Saute

Heat 1 tbsp neutral oil in a wide skillet over medium-high. Stir-fry carrot and onion 2–3 minutes until just tender. Add shiitake, cook 90 seconds until softened. Lift out onto a plate.

4

Sear

Raise heat to high, add remaining 1 tbsp neutral oil. Stir-fry marinated pork in batches if needed 2–3 minutes per batch until deeply caramelized and just cooked through.

5

Glaze

Return vegetables and noodles to the pan. Add remaining 2 tbsp soy, 4 tsp mirin, 2 tsp sugar, 1.3 tbsp sesame oil, and 4 remaining garlic cloves. Toss 2 minutes over medium heat until glossy and well coated.

6

Plate

Transfer japchae to plates, scatter scallions and 2 tsp toasted sesame seeds over the top. Serve immediately.
